Wind cannot pass through, rain cannot pass through, but light can—that is the unique quality of window glass.

During the day, if you enter a room without windows and close the door, the space will be engulfed in darkness. In such a dark, lightless place, a person is like a blind person, unable to see anything. To find direction or a target, one can only grope about, and performing detailed tasks becomes impossible. However, the moment a glass window is installed on the wall, light pours in, and the room instantly brightens. Everything inside becomes clear and visible, making any task simple and easy to accomplish.

The more—and the larger—the windows in a room, the more light it receives, and the brighter it becomes. Glass windows keep out the wind, rain, and cold, yet allow light and warmth to flow in.

In places devoid of natural light, darkness and dampness prevail, and life becomes fragile. For example, leek plants turn pale yellow without sunlight because the lack of sunlight prevents photosynthesis, depriving them of energy and thereby weakening their vitality.
